Majuba Power Station consists of evaporative cooling water systems which are designed to dissipate
heat from water by air contact, from condenser and air-conditioning systems. However, such
systems can provide an environment for the growth of many microorganisms, including Legionella.
Legionella causes Legionnaires disease which is a serious infection acquired by inhalation of water
droplets from cooling water systems that contain Legionella bacteria.. Legionella can grow and
spread in both open- and closed-circuit cooling tower system, thus periodic monitoring and control
is critical.

3. Provision of Legionella of service for the analysis in water samples as per ISO
11731 for 5 Years
Legionella bacteria are naturally present in all surface waters and can cause a pneumonia-like
disease,
which may be fatal. This risk is increased in the older people and immunocompromised.
Legionnaires disease can only be contracted when the bacteria is inhaled into the lungs in a form of
aerosol sized water droplets.
The water spray cooling zone of cooling towers is an area of increased risk due to the forced
minimisation of water droplet size to facilitate maximum cooling. The region around the cooling tower
where windage and spray comes to contact with personnel are the main areas of concern.
The SANS standard for Legionella specifies the need for continuous monitoring and control and
reduction of the Legionella. Legionella analysis cannot be conducted at any Eskom power Station
Laboratories until the laboratory is ISO 11731 accredited to be able to carry out the analysis.
3.1
a) Analysis of Legionella in water samples quarterly in an accredited Laboratory as per as per ISO
11731 as and when it is required.
b) To conduct confirmation test for all positive results as and when required as per ISO 11731
c) Contractor to provide sampling bottles for the legionella samples as per ISO 11731 as and when
required.
d) Contractor to provide detailed report for the analysis to the employer as and when analysis has
been completed with not later than 12 days turnaround time.
e) Contractor must submit laboratory accreditation certificate yearly for the Legionella analysis for
the laboratory that will be used to conduct the analysis to the employer.
f) Legionella samples must be collected quarterly and report analysis to be sent to the employer
not later those 12 days after samples collection.
g) All adhoc samples to be collected as and when employer requires and report analysis not later
than 12 days after samples collection.
